If you’ve been to a Columbus Crew game this season, you’ve probably seen the Donate Life booth! We set up shop before every home game with fun activities and giveaways like hero masks and capes.
Why heroes?
Because you don’t have to be on the soccer field to be a hero! You can be a hero by saying “yes” to organ and tissue donation. Just one donor has the potential to save eight lives through organ donation and enhance 50 more lives by donating tissue. Transplant recipients everywhere consider their donors to be heroes, giving second chances at life.
Our partnership with the Columbus Crew this season is centered around our “Heroes On and Off the Field” campaign. The campaign features five players, all heroes on and off the field.
All of our heroes - Danny O’Rourke, Olman Vargas, Julius James, Matt Lampson and Bernardo Añor - are registered organ and tissue donors. You can check out our photo shoot with the players here.
Añor is also a tissue recipient and can play the game he loves thanks to his donor!
